How to hit home runs: I swing as hard as I can, and I try to swing right through the ball... The harder you grip the bat, the more you can swing it through the ball, and the farther the ball will go. I swing big, with everything I've got. I hit big or I miss big. I like to live as big as I can.
Babe Ruth

Interpretation

What this quote means

This quote emphasizes the importance of taking bold actions in pursuit of one's goals.

Babe Ruth’s quote reflects a philosophy of living life to the fullest by embracing boldness and effort. By advocating for a strong, determined approach—swinging hard at opportunities—Ruth suggests that greater risks can lead to greater rewards. The metaphor of swinging for home runs symbolizes pursuing ambitious goals and living an engaged, passionate life, even if it means facing failures along the way. In essence, it encourages individuals to give their all and not shy away from challenges.

Aw, everybody knows that game, the day I hit the homer off ole Charlie Root there in Wrigley Field, the day October first, the third game of that thirty-two World Series. But right now I want to settle all arguments. I didn't exactly point to any spot, like the flagpole. Anyway, I didn't mean to, I just sorta waved at the whole fence, but that was foolish enough. All I wanted to do was give that thing a ride... outta the park... anywhere.
Babe RuthRead
